1. Natural Language Processing (NLP):
ASRI AI would likely include NLP capabilities such as:
Sentiment Analysis: Determining the emotional tone of text (positive, negative, neutral).
Text Summarization: Condensing large volumes of text into concise summaries.
Named Entity Recognition (NER): Identifying and classifying named entities (people, organizations, locations) within text.
Machine Translation: Translating text from one language to another.
2. Machine Learning (ML):
ASRI AI would likely incorporate a range of machine learning algorithms, enabling tasks such as:
Classification: Categorizing data into predefined classes (e.g., spam detection).
Regression: Predicting continuous values (e.g., stock price prediction).
Clustering: Grouping similar data points together (e.g., customer segmentation).
Model Training and Evaluation: Using training data to build accurate models and evaluating their performance using metrics like accuracy and precision.
3. Computer Vision:
If ASRI AI is a comprehensive platform, it would also include computer vision capabilities like:
Image Classification: Identifying objects or scenes within images.
Object Detection: Locating and identifying multiple objects within an image.
Image Segmentation: Partitioning an image into meaningful regions.
Facial Recognition: Identifying individuals based on their facial features.
4. Data Analytics:
ASRI AI could provide tools for analyzing large datasets to uncover insights, trends, and patterns. This might include features like:
Data Visualization: Presenting data in clear and informative ways through charts and graphs.
Statistical Analysis: Applying statistical methods to understand data distributions and relationships.
Predictive Analytics: Using historical data to forecast future outcomes.
